Transaction 57ab401308ebf08e01bf7ef4eb527a11f8d79d067f11a30d3aa5d6101f271296

1 Input
1 Outputs
  • 57ab401308ebf08e01bf7ef4eb527a11f8d79d067f11a30d3aa5d6101f271296:0
  • value  9615170
    address  3EbmcoMxveRW95CNwkHGPJ1tZ5r3Fv6TKB